Philly Bike Polo Logo

 

A little earlier this fall I helped throw a bike polo event for the Philly Bike Expo. At some point it became necessary for the Philly club to have a logo. Here’s a little thing I cooked up at the 11th hour.

polo_logo2

After the dust had settled I received an unexpected bit of mail. A special “thank you” from Bina, the Expo organizer. She had gotten my logo made into a custom bicycle head badge! So cool!

Le Tour Art Prints

Eleanor and I took a bicycle tour last year hitting up some of the highlights of the Tour de France. We were so inspired by the trip that we decided collaborate on a series of art prints.
